Shekhinah shines with most #SAMA24 nominations─── 08:53 Sat, 05 May 2018

Sultry vocalist Shekhinah has raked in the most nominations as SAMA24 unveiled the finalists in the highly coveted and competitive top 5 categories.
Her album, Rose Gold, earned her a spot in the Female of the Year, Newcomer of the Year and Album of the Year categories, bringing her total SAMA24 tally to six.
She is up for Record of the Year for Suited and Best Produced and Best Pop Album for Rose Gold.
Mafikizolo continue their winning ways with two nominations in Duo/Group of the Year and Album of the Year for 20. Their new total number of nods stands at six with others in Best Afro-pop Album, Best Engineered Album and Best Produced Album plus Record of the Year for Love Potion.
Rapper Shane Eagle proves to have had a great year with two nods in Newcomer of the Year and Album of the Year. He’s already nominated for Best Hip Hop Album and Music Video of the Year.
Lady Zamar announces her arrival on the scene with nods in Female Artist of the Year and Album of the Year. She has two nominations in the Record of the Year for My Baby and Love is Blind.
Tresor’s Beautiful Madness booked him two berths in the top five categories, in Male Artist of the Year and Album of the Year.
Along with the announcement, SAMA24 also unveiled Yesterday, Today and Tomorrow as the theme of this year’s awards.
RiSA CEO Nhlanhla Sibisi says they are proud of their nominees and believe that they are worthy and now the stage is set to see who will take home a SAMA24 trophy come June 2 in Sun City.
